Installing Ford Vehicle Start: Selecting the Perfect Kit and Fitting Procedures
Want to add comfort to your Ford? Installing a car start system can be a fantastic DIY task, but picking the appropriate kit is essential . First, determine your Ford's year and engine type. Some kits are truck-specific, while others are more generic . Look for capabilities like proximity entry compatibility , distance , and guarantee . Once you have your kit, readiness is key . Carefully review the guide and assemble your equipment, which typically include circuit strippers, connectors, a multimeter , and perhaps a joining device for some connections. Then, sticking with the manual , detach the car's electrical system, locate the appropriate circuits , and connect the car start module . At the end, attaching the battery and testing the operation is critical . Always to consult digital forums and tutorials for more assistance !
